  • What are the top cultural and historical sites in Honolulu?

    The Iolani Palace is a must-see, being the only official residence of royalty in the United States. The USS Arizona Memorial at Pearl Harbor is another important site, offering a poignant reminder of the events of 1941. And don't forget the Bishop Museum, which showcases Hawaiian history and culture.

  • How is the public transportation system in Honolulu?

    The public transportation system in Honolulu is called TheBus. It's a good option for getting around, especially within the city. You can purchase a day pass or a multi-day pass for unlimited rides. However, for longer distances, consider renting a car for greater flexibility.

  • Which seasonal events or festivals should apartment renters look forward to in Honolulu?

    The annual Aloha Festivals in September and October are a must-see, celebrating Hawaiian culture with parades, music, and traditional food. The Waikiki Spam Jam in April is a fun event featuring spam dishes from local restaurants. And the Honolulu Pride Festival in June is a vibrant celebration of diversity.
